What is MCV in visa?
An MCV visa (also known as Maritime Crew Visa), is a visa available to US citizens coming by sea into Australia as a part of a sea crew. This seaman visa for Australia also allows family members of the marine crew member who are traveling to Australia to apply along with the crew member.

How do I apply for an Australian Maritime crew visa?
To be eligible for the Maritime Crew Visa (Subclass 988), you will need to:
- Be outside Australia when you apply.
- You must be an articled crew member on a non-military ship that is taking an international voyage to Australia.
- Meet the character requirement.
- Have paid back your debts to the Australian government.
